Cawthorne's Endowed School is a primary school for pupils aged 3 to 11 in Lancaster, within the Lancashire local authority. It has a Christian religious character. The school has around 40 pupils on roll. At its most recent graded Ofsted inspection in 05/03/2024, Cawthorne's Endowed School was judged Good.
